spookwife Posted January 24, 2013 #15 Share Posted January 24, 2013 By the way...what in the world is the Kummelweck? it's the bun style that the sammich is served up on.. crusty on the outside, squishy on the inside, sprinkled with coarse salt and pretty dang yummy. rednancy1 Posted January 24, 2013 #19 Share Posted January 24, 2013 The Kummelweck sandwich has been such a big hit that RCI is putting a Park Cafe on every ship. :) Only a handful of ships have them now. Oasis and Allure are two. I can't remember the others. The Legend will get a Park Cafe when she goes into drydock in early Feb. Does anyone else know what ships have them? :)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
